Mezco Gambit is ready to play some cards

By Darryn Bonthuys
October 9, 2019 - 6 years ago

The One:12 Collective Gambit is outfitted in a black mission suit with an X-Men issued armoured vest and removable leather-look overcoat. Complete with 2 head portraits, the master of kinetic energy comes complete with a bo staff and a variety of throwing cards and throwing card FX.
